My Daimler 6 (european) 1995,
I have no key and I'm stuck. A locksmith failed in programming transponder (EEPROM in the reader exciter?) Any idea,?
If I want to buy a set (barrels, key) do I have to find reader exciter+security module, all from the same car?

If you are buying a replacement key you will also need to install the matching security module in the trunk above and to the front of the filler cap otherwise you will need dealer level software to program the security module to accept a different key. It is not necessary to replace the exciter module under the steering column. The exciter module is the same on all X300 jaguars with ROW security. It just reads the key chip and passes the information to the security module which confirms this is the correct key and instructs the body processor module to enable injection.

Jaguar does not publish circuit details of modules so I don't know what is inside. The exciter is a small module located under the steering column. As far as I know it's function is only to read the transponder chip in the key and pass this to the security module in the trunk. It is the security module in the trunk that checks if the key is valid not the exciter. The key code will be stored in an EEPROM and this could be read and reconfigured using a bin file but you would need to know the memory locations to change in the EEPROM and what they should be to changed to. It is likely that the EEPROM will be in the security module and not the exciter. This is the module that is coded for a new key using Jaguar dealer level software. It may be worthwhile seeking out a garage or dealer that has the correct diagnostic software to reprogram a key rather than a locksmith.
